Yes you can, but there are certain mandatory things you must do;
All lights capable of emitting blue must be covered, if fitted with blue lenses and de-activated when on road. I.e. removal of fuses etc. Lights emitting blue but with clear lenese are acceptable as long as fuese are removed.
All force specific items such as crests, website addresses, and any 'POLICE' wording must be covered when on the public road. 'Not in Service' signs must also be present. Battenburg markings are ok, along with rear chevrons and roof codes.
Log book must be filled in for all journeys on the road, for fuel, battery charging, road testing and travel to shows etc.
So, it can be used...but carefully :y
